Step 1

From the Bundles & Promotion navigation pane, select Bundles. The Bundles list displays.
 

Step 2

Click the Create By Date button at the top of the list. The Create By Date pop-up displays.
 

Step 3

The Types To Include drop-down list pre-selects all record types (by highlighting them in blue). Use Ctrl+click to de-select any record type for records that you do not want in the Bundle.
 

Note
titleNote

Only records for record types that you have permission to Read will be included in the bundle.

Step 4

The Updated On Or After field specifies the current date, by default. You can change the date manually or by clicking the Calendar icon. All records created or updated on or after the date that you specify will be included in the bundle.

Step 5

Enter a Name and, optionally, select one more Business Services that this Bundle will be a member of. Then click the Submit button. If any records qualified for inclusion in the Bundle, the Bundle is created, saved to the database, and the Preparing Bundles for Promotion#Bundle Bundle Details display below the list. However, if no records qualified according to the specified date, the Bundle is not saved.

Step 6

You then can open the Bundle and enter / select additional Details for the Bundle, using the field descriptions below as a guide.

  • Required fields display an asterisk ( * ) after the field name.
  • Default values for fields, if available, display automatically.

To display more of the Details fields on the screen, you can temporarily hide the list.

Step 7

As desired, you also can add any additional records to (or remove any included records from) the Bundle.

Step 8

Click the Update button.

Step 1

From the Bundles & Promotion navigation pane, select Bundles. The Bundles list displays.
 

Step 2

Click the Create Bundle By Business Service button at the top of the list. The Create Bundle By Business Service pop-up displays.
 

Step 3

In the Member of Business Services field, specify Business Service memberships for the Bundle being created. Otherwise, if your Bundle permissions are limited to specific Business Services, you may not be able to create the Bundle.

Step 4

The Types To Include drop-down list pre-selects all record types (by highlighting them in blue) for records that can belong to Business Services. Use Ctrl+click to de-select any record type for records that you do not want in the Bundle.
 

Note
titleNote

Only records for record types that you have permission to Read will be included in the bundle.

Step 4

In the Business Services To Include field, select one or more Business Services whose records you want to include in the Bundle.

Step 5

Enter a Name and, optionally, select one more Business Services that this Bundle will be a member of. Then click the Submit button. If any records qualified for inclusion in the Bundle, the Bundle is created, saved to the database, and the Preparing Bundles for Promotion#Bundle Bundle Details display below the list. However, if no records qualified according to the specified Business Service(s), the Bundle is not saved.

Step 6

You then can open the Bundle and enter / select additional Details for the Bundle, using the field descriptions below as a guide.

  • Required fields display an asterisk ( * ) after the field name.
  • Default values for fields, if available, display automatically.

To display more of the Details fields on the screen, you can temporarily hide the list.

Step 7

As desired, you also can add any additional records to (or remove any included records from) the Bundle.

Step 8

Click the Update button.

Adding Multiple Records to a Bundle from a Records List
Adding Multiple Records to a Bundle from a Records List
Adding Multiple Records to a Bundle from a Records List

Step 1

Display the list of records containing the records that you want to add to a Bundle.

Step 2

Either:
 
Ctrl-click the records that you want to add to the Bundle, display the Action menu, and select Add To Bundle. The Add To Bundle pop-up displays.
 

 
OR
 
On any tasks list, right-click any column header for the list, display the Action menu, and select Run Command On Filtered > Add To Bundle.... The Add To Bundle pop-up displays.
 

Step 4

Select a Name from the drop-down list and click Submit. The records are added to the Bundle (see Preparing Bundles for Promotion#Displaying Displaying the Bundles List for a Record).
